Description

This qualification reflects the role of individuals who assist with the delivery of sport and recreation activities and who complete a range of fundamental customer contact and maintenance duties. They work under direct supervision to complete mainly routine tasks.
This qualification provides a pathway to work for any type of sport, aquatic or recreation organisation including commercial, not-for-profit, community and government organisations.
The skills in this qualification must be applied in accordance with Commonwealth and State or Territory legislation, Australian standards and industry codes of practice.
No occupational licensing, certification or specific legislative requirements apply to this qualification at the time of publication.

Schedule
Packaging Rules
Ten (10) units must be completed:
- Six (6) core units
- Four (4) elective units, consisting of:
- Two (2) units from the list below
- Two (2) units from the list below, elsewhere in SIS Training Package, or any other current Training Package or accredited course.

The selection of electives must be guided by the job outcome sought, local industry requirements and the complexity of skills appropriate to the AQF level of this qualification.
1. Core Units

All six (6) units must be completed.
